Rental Criteria
Rental Criteria:
127 Rentals is dedicated to ensuring equal housing opportunity, the protection of our landlords’ financial interest and property, and the ability of our tenants to enjoy a peaceful and rewarding rental experience. To meet these responsibilities, the following is the rental criteria policy.
Equal Housing Opportunity:
127 Rentals follows a policy of fair and equal treatment to all persons regardless of race, color, religion, national origin, familial status, sex, disability, or source of funds and in compliance with all Federal, State and Local Laws.
Rental Applications:
Each potential resident who is 18 years old or older must complete a separate rental application, and must individually meet the rental criteria. Incomplete and/or inaccurate applications or applications submitted without the proper application fee(s) will not be considered and will not be refunded. All Co-Applicants applying together must individually meet the established criteria. If any Co-Applicant fails to meet the criteria, the associated Co-Applicants will also be denied.
Application Fee:
A non-refundable application processing fee of $25 will be charged before an application is processed. This amount is non-refundable regardless of the outcome of the application or the reason for that outcome.
Credit History:
A credit score of 600 or above is required for applicant approval. Credit scores of 540 to 599 may be approved with a Guarantor and/or additional security deposit, at Management discretion. Applicants with no established credit score may be approved with a Guarantor, at Management discretion.
Income Verification:
Applicants must establish a gross income of at least three (3) times the monthly rent. Co-applicants must demonstrate a combined gross income of at least three (3) times the monthly rent. The required gross income may be established utilizing the following methods.
a. Signed two consecutive pay stubs from current employer(s), dated to within the past sixty days, and must include applicant name, address, company name, and gross annual salary to date.
b. Signed employment contracts, letters, or statements of funds, or a verification of employment form on letterhead.
c. W2, 1099, and/or 1040 forms. Original must be verified.
d. Government/ Court Ordered documents detailing benefits.
e. 3 consecutive bank statements dated within the past 120 days can be used for verifying funds and the following conditions will apply: the bank statements must be in the applicant’s name and must reflect a minimum balance equal to or greater than 3 times the monthly rental amount multiplied by the number of months in the requested lease term.
ID Verification:
Each applicant must provide a valid government issued photo identification, as well as a Social Security Number or Tax Identification Number.
Previous Rental History:
Rental history must be positive, including demonstrating full compliance with past rental agreements, no disruptive conduct or damage to property, and no outstanding balance with past landlords. Negative rental history will result in application denial.
Criminal Background:
A criminal background check will be conducted on all applicants. Applicants must not have been convicted of the illegal manufacture or distribution of a controlled substance as defined in federal law or a crime involving harm to persons or property within the last seven years. Management retains the right to deny any applicant whose criminal conviction history demonstrates that they pose a clear and present threat to the health or safety of other individuals, or substantial harm to others or the dwelling itself.

Cosigners:
A cosigner will be allowed for applications that are accepted on a conditional basis.
The cosigner’s application must qualify with a minimum risk score of 600 or higher and provide verifiable funds that show 3 times the monthly rent. Guarantor responsibilities include paying of rent, late fees, utilities (if applicable), and payment of damages should the resident default in areas of the lease agreement. Guarantors are required to complete an application, pay an application fee of $25, and agree to be screened. The guarantor is bound by all statutes of the lease agreement and agrees to comply with all aspects of the lease. Cosigners must meet all criteria on their own to be eligible.
Security Deposit:
A full deposit equal to one month’s rent must be paid at the lease signing. The security deposit is eligible for refund at move out according to the terms of the Lease Agreement.
Pet Policy:
Not all properties allow pets. Refer to the listing to verify if pets are allowed. There is a two (2) pet maximum, and a weight restriction of 45 pounds. A Non-Refundable Pet Fee of $300 and a Pet Rent of $25 per pet is standard. Photo verification of applicants’ pet(s) is required, and current compliance with all applicable regulations regarding vaccinations, etc. must be verified.
The following restrictions apply:
Only ordinary house pets shall be permitted. Ordinary houses pets shall include dogs, cats, caged domesticated birds, hamsters, gerbils, and guinea pigs, aquarium fish, small turtles and tortoises, so long as such animals are normally maintained in a terrarium or aquarium.
The following breeds or dogs mixed with these breeds are NOT permitted including, but not limited to: Akitas, Pit Bulls (aka American Staffordshire Terriers, Staffordshire Bull Terriers, or American Pit Bull Terriers), Presa Canarios, Bull Terriers, Bull Mastiffs, German Shepherds, Huskies, Malamutes, Doberman Pinschers, Rottweilers, Shar-peis, Chow Chows, wolf hybrids, and Rhodesian Ridgebacks.

Application Review and Selection Process:
At 127 Rentals LLC, we are committed to ensuring a fair and equitable application process. In the event that multiple applications are received for a property, we reserve the right to select the most qualified applicant based on the following guidelines:
Application Processing: All applications will be reviewed and processed to ensure that each applicant is given an equal opportunity to be considered.
Equal Qualifications: If all applicants meet the same qualifications, preference will be given to the applicant who submits their application first.
Higher Qualification Criteria: If subsequent applicants are more qualified than earlier applicants (for example, based on credit history, job stability, income level, or landlord references), the more qualified applicant will be given priority.
